How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Waterfront?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Waterfront Studio Apartments | $1,947 | $1,245 | $2,728 |
| Waterfront 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,544 | $1,240 | $8,589 |
| Waterfront 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,990 | $1,730 | $10,000+ |
| Waterfront 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,003 | $1,505 | $10,000+ |
| Waterfront 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,581 | $1,235 | $2,415 |
